#ac1e0f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ac1e0f is composed of 67.5% red, 11.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5.7 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 36.7%. #ac1e0f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3c1e with #590000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#ac1e0f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ac1e0f has RGB values of R:172, G:30,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.91,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11279887.

Hex triplet ac1e0f #ac1e0f
RGB Decimal 172, 30, 15 rgb(172,30,15)
RGB Percent 67.5, 11.8, 5.9 rgb(67.5%,11.8%,5.9%)
CMYK 0, 83, 91, 33
HSL 5.7°, 84, 36.7 hsl(5.7,84%,36.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 5.7°, 91.3, 67.5
Web Safe 993300 #993300
CIE-LAB 37.364, 54.78, 45.082
XYZ 17.565, 9.736, 1.406
xyY 0.612, 0.339, 9.736
CIE-LCH 37.364, 70.945, 39.453
CIE-LUV 37.364, 107.255, 26.124
Hunter-Lab 31.202, 45.878, 19.169
Binary 10101100, 00011110, 00001111

Shades and Tints of #ac1e0f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ac1e0f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645857 is the less saturated color, while #ba1201 is the most saturated one.
